C10-T1 Uplifter

Description
Summary: Barebones warp-capable T1 cargo lifter. Useful for escaping the starter world as soon as possible on an MP server.

Coming in at just 150 t yet boasting a lift capacity of 2.7 kt @ 0.9g, this tiny lifter will take you from humble beginnings to greater things without having to leave anything behind.

Additional Notes:
- nearly 190 kSU of cargo lift and storage capacity
- Features a fridge, O2 station, detector, and a small constructor
- Minimum construction time, and requires no Sathium except for the warp drive
